Long-term cognitive and brain morphologic changes in chronic heart failure: Results of the Cognition.Matters-HF study.

Jan TraubGyörgy HomolaCaroline MorbachRoxanne SellDennis GöpfertStefan FrantzMirko PhamGuido StollStefan StörkAnna Frey
Published in: ESC heart failure (2024)
In patients with stable HF patients receiving guideline-directed pharmacologic treatment and regular medical care, the presence of CI did not affect overall and hospitalization-free 6-year survival. The loss of brain parenchyma observed in patients with stable HF did not exceed that of normal ageing.
